I want to buy an inflatable hobie kayak. Either used i11s or the new to be released itrex11. I can not get the CTi seats that I have tested to be comfortable. They pinch at the sides and set off my siatica nerves making my legs go numb after about 25 minutes of peddling. I don’t have this problem with the CT seats I have used.

Question: Is there a way to adapt a CT seat to an inflatable Hobie with pedal drive?

If nobody can provide specific info, I can outline my similar quest for alternate iT11 seat. Of about a dozen videos I have posted, a recent one on iT9 showed the seat anchor setup in fullscreen just for a moment. It appears to be a simple and emerging standard way of locking into crossbar legs. I think i11s may have a more custom setup which you might find depicted on video, but I would be surprised if you could find one for sale anyway.

Well, I forget the details, but got the impression that a lot of common seat designs could be improvised to fit iTreks although maybe misaligned to half of the hull friction pads. I was inspired by another inflato pedal kayak maker who doesn't include seats, but shows a decadent, premium beach chair in use with generous width, height, armrests, and reclinability. You have to have unusual amount of recline to pedal and of course sturdiness. The iT11 can probably take a lot bigger seat than iT9 without getting tippy. I also may use a SeaEagle inflatable seat; I even have a jumbo one they no longer sell.
